Housing Insights for ZIP Code 48235 (Detroit, MI)

Housing Summary for ZIP Code 48235

Homeowners

The median home value in ZIP Code 48235 (Detroit, MI) is $53,900. Approximately 58.0% of homes in this region are owner-occupied units, and the estimated homeowner vacancy rate is currently 4.9%.

The average occupancy of owner-occupied units in ZIP Code 48235 is 2.30 occupants, while owner-occupied units have an aggregate average size of 2.68 bedrooms per housing unit.

Renters

In the 48235 ZIP Code, an estimated 42.0% of all housing units are occupied by renters. This ZIP-defined region has is an estimated rental vacany rate of 2.6%.

Among renter-occupied units in this ZIP, the average occupancy is 2.82 occupants, while renters in this Wayne County region spend an average of 0% of their income on housing rental costs.

Home Values in ZIP Code 48235 (Detroit, MI)

The median home value in ZIP Code 48235 is $53,900. That median value is about 65% lower than the median home value of $154,900 in Michigan overall, and is 75% lower than the $217,500 the median home value in the entire U.S. An estimated 44.6% of homes in ZIP Code 48235 are valued less than $50,000. That is 284% higher than in Michigan, in which 11.6% of homes are valued at less than $50,000, and is about 546% higher than in the U.S. overall (6.9% of homes valued at less than $50,000). The home value range that the smallest portion of ZIP Code 48235 homes fall into is $1,000,000 or more (0.1% of homes).

Home Ages in ZIP Code 48235 (Detroit, MI)

Approximately 53.4% of homes in this Detroit, MI region were built in 1950 to 1959. This amount of homes built in 1950 to 1959 in ZIP Code 48235 is about 258% higher than percentage of homes built in this time period in Michigan overall (14.9% of homes), and is 418% higher the percentage (10.3% of homes) in the U.S. as a whole. Additionally, an esimated 27.7% of local homes were built in 1940 to 1949. On the other end of the scale, just 0.0% of homes in this Wayne County ZIP Code were built in 2014 or later in ZIP Code 48235. In comparison, 1.3% of homes in Michigan overall were built in 2014 or later, while 2.5% of all U.S. homes were built in this time period.
